5 stars I must admit I was behind and discovered Magic Pie just a few weeks ago. But it took me only a few listenings to their two previous albums (Motions of desire, 2005 & Circus of life, 2007) until I was hooked. This third album immediately satisfy my hunger for true energetic progrock with lots of dynamics and complexity. I now already know one 2011-album that will make a great play-count on my laptop the next months. And I hope on a great deal of others as well. Wondering how on earth is it possible to be be a Norwegian music interested consumer reading lots of Norwegian music reviews and discussions but still not see or hear anything from any Norwegian person, newspaper, TV- or radio-channel about such an amazingly skillful band like this? It feels almost like being fooled by someone trying to keep the best candy to him self. Don't bee fooled like me. Check out this inspiring album and enjoy every second.
